WebFeb 12, 2013 · Maybe I used to wash bottle necked rifle brass on too humid a day. After towel drying I'd put them in a warm oven with the oven off and come back when it all cooled down, a couple hours. A Q-Tip pushed to the bottom of the case would come out damp for some shells, not all of them though. WebJul 14, 2024 · The RCBS is a 2 part "clam shell" style separator. I fill one half of the separator with water about 90% full, then put the basket in, and pour in the pins/brass. You then turn the basket for 20-30 seconds, and 99.9% of the pins are out, at least for bottleneck rifle brass. Pistol brass usually much easier. WebJan 19, 2024 · Oven Dry in Pre-Heated Oven — After pre-heating to 200° or so, turn off oven and put brass inside on a tray. Most important! Tell your wife what you are doing so she doesn’t crank it up to 425 to heat pizza! — MClark NOTE: Many other members suggested oven drying at 150-200°. WebJul 15, 2024 · Drying in the oven is fine. It takes 600 degrees and over to anneal, so well less than that is OK. It's summer time in NC, so I use the free heat generator in the sky; brass on a dark towel will dry in a few minutes, I leave it over an hour. WebMay 25, 2024 · Oven at about 220 degrees. Been doing it for years. Drain the excess water and leave in for about 30 minutes then air cool and you are done. Excess water might need more time. I use muffin trays for rifle brass with the base up. I find the temperature doesn't affect brass and extra time souldn't hurt. Paul : -)# Author Posted December 17, 2016 WebMay 8, 2024 · 18. You should really clean off your brass after lubing/ sizing to keep the bolt thrust down. The Brit's used to use greased cartridges to proof their rifles-- that's how much it can increase your bolt thrust by having "wet" cartridges go in the chamber.

WebJul 24, 2015 · This is, IMHO, the best way to clean brass. I have been de-capping the brass before tumbling, cleaning, rolling in a towel to remove excess surface water, and then placing in a 200 degree oven for 20 minutes to dry. This has worked well and I have no complaints.
